The battle for Indonesian eyeballs is not just in cinemas but also on the small screen, where a fierce "streaming war" is underway. The OTT market is projected to be worth and is expected to grow to $1.91 billion by 2030. Digital video is at the epicenter of this boom, with the online video market estimated at $1.5 billion and growing at an annual rate of 14%. A fascinating dynamic has emerged: local content has reached parity with international hits . In the final quarter of 2025, Indonesian productions equaled the viewership share of Korean programming, both capturing 30% of the market, a historic milestone indicating a powerful shift in viewer preference.
Perhaps the most unique facet of Indonesian popular videos is the rise of rural creators. Living in villages across Java, Sumatra, and Sulawesi, these creators produce videos about sawah (rice field) life, traditional cooking, and dagelan (slapstick rural comedy). Channels like (a massive family vlog) and Ricis Official (lifestyle and challenge videos) have built empires that generate hundreds of millions of dollars, proving that you do not need a Jakarta address to become a star.
However, this new era of digital popularity is not without its challenges. The algorithm-driven nature of popular videos has led to a homogenization of content. If a "POV" (Point of View) video about a ojol (online motorcycle taxi driver) goes viral, thousands of copycats follow, flooding the feed and stifling originality. Moreover, the pressure to produce constant content has led to a rise in "prank" culture, which occasionally crosses the line into public disturbance or criminal behavior.
